Abstract

In this paper, we propose a novel approach, which reuses Traditional Chinese Cartoon to create new animations. In order to extract the cartoon character precisely, a segmentation method based on edge detection is implemented. Before reusing the data, a lower- dimensional space of the cartoon data is constructed by ISOmap. The character's gesture difference calculated by optical flow is combined with character's edge difference through a novel distance function, which is controlled by a weight parameter. The animation is created by reordering the existing data into a sequence, which is the shortest path between two designated data in the space. Our approach utilizes image processing, computer vision, and machine learning in cartoon creation and the experiment results demonstrate that the animation's quality can be effectively improved by the fusion of these techniques.
